HF alkylation with product recycle employing two reactors
A method is described for continuously preparing alkylate by contacting olefin with paraffin in the presence of HF catalyst. The method consists of: (a) contacting about one-half of the total olefin feed stock with fresh and recycle paraffin in the presence of HF catalyst in a first reactor to produce a first reactor product effluent, the reactants present in a ratio of paraffin to olefin of about 6:1 to about 100:1; (b) discharging the first reactor product effluent into a settled HF catalyst is discharged from the base and reactor product effluent comprising alkylate, unreacted feed stock and HF catalyst is removed above the reactor effluent inlet to the settler; (c) recycling a portion of the reactor product effluent from the settler into contact with the remaining about one-half of the total olefin feed stock in the presence of HF catalyst in a second riser reactor to produce a second reactor product effluent, the reactants present in a ratio of about 6:1 to about 100:1; (d) discharging the second reactor product effluent into the settler; (e) discharging settled HF catalyst from the settler base; (f) proportioning the HF catalyst between the first and the second riser reactor; and (g) recovering as system product from the settler the portion.
